Hello all,

Does anyone managed to get running Heat service if using Endpoint filter driver in Keystone? Looks like Heat admin user in heat domain did not work, because of empty catalog list. Could it be a issue?

Error in heat-engine:

2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server [req-51bbb19c-bc59-41f7-b420-a7ab1a2b64c9 96354895967c45cdbc57e28e4fbad851 0675f664ad494e92aa8fd16815d6b167 - - -] Exception during message handling 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server Traceback (most recent call last): 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/oslo_messaging/rpc/server.py", line 133, in _process_incoming 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server res = self.dispatcher.dispatch(message)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/oslo_messaging/rpc/dispatcher.py", line 150, in dispatch 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return self._do_dispatch(endpoint, method, ctxt, args)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/oslo_messaging/rpc/dispatcher.py", line 121, in _do_dispatch 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server result = func(ctxt, **new_args)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/osprofiler/profiler.py", line 154, in wrapper 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return f(*args, **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/common/context.py", line 424, in wrapped 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return func(self, ctx, *args, **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/service.py", line 809, in create_stack 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server _create_stack_user(stack)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/service.py", line 776, in _create_stack_user 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server stack.create_stack_user_project_id() 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/osprofiler/profiler.py", line 154, in wrapper 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return f(*args, **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/stack.py", line 1941, in create_stack_user_project_id 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server 'keystone').create_stack_domain_project(self.id)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/clients/os/keystone/heat_keystoneclient.py", line 397, in create_stack_domain_project 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server domain_project = self.domain_admin_client.projects.create( 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/clients/os/keystone/heat_keystoneclient.py", line 154, in domain_admin_client 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server auth=self.domain_admin_auth, 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/heat/engine/clients/os/keystone/heat_keystoneclient.py", line 140, in domain_admin_auth 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server auth.get_token(self.session)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/identity/base.py", line 90, in get_token 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return self.get_access(session).auth_token 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/identity/base.py", line 136, in get_access 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server self.auth_ref = self.get_auth_ref(session)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/identity/generic/base.py", line 181, in get_auth_ref 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return self._plugin.get_auth_ref(session, **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/identity/v3/base.py", line 167, in get_auth_ref 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server authenticated=False, log=False, **rkw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/session.py", line 675, in post 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return self.request(url, 'POST', **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/positional/__init__.py", line 101, in inner 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server return wrapped(*args, **kwargs)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server File "/usr/lib/python2.7/dist-packages/keystoneauth1/session.py", line 570, in request 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server raise exceptions.from_response(resp, method, url) 2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server BadRequest: object of type 'NoneType' has no len() (HTTP 400) (Request-ID: req-9c36a7df-35ff-498c-a6b3-f0e8f99a0786)
2017-07-24 16:44:14.759 11617 ERROR oslo_messaging.rpc.server
2017-07-24 16:44:14.829 11617 DEBUG oslo_messaging._drivers.amqpdriver [req-51bbb19c-bc59-41f7-b420-a7ab1a2b64c9 96354895967c45cdbc57e28e4fbad851 0675f664ad494e92aa8fd16815d6b167 - - -] sending reply msg_id: 523ffc4190b04729ad7dd5d36b734159 reply queue: reply_d9493a0097404289904a2cbfb9625855 time elapsed: 1.17097278702s _send_reply /usr/lib/python2.7/dist-packages/oslo_messaging/_drivers/amqpdriver.py:73


_______________________________________________
Mailing list: http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ack
Post to     : openstack@lists.openstack.org
Unsubscribe : http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ack

Reply via email to